Microblading is a semi-permanent kind of beauty tattooing. But not like traditional tattoos, which make use of a tattoo gun, microblading takes advantage of a blade-formed tool with a row of small, scarcely seen needles to make hair-like strokes alongside your brows though depositing pigment into the skin. The end result? Practical-wanting brow hairs that don’t wash off for the year or even more.
